免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ios证书是怎么回事

iOS证书是一种用于iOS设备的数字证书,用于验证应用程序的身份和安全性。在开发iOS应用程序时,开发人员需要使用证书来签署他们的应用程序,以便在App Store上发布应用程序。本文将介绍iOS证书的原理和详细信息。

iOS证书的原理

iOS证书是由苹果公司颁发的数字证书。数字证书是一种用于验证身份和安全性的电子文档。它们是由权威机构颁发的,以确保其可信度和安全性。在iOS开发中,证书用于验证应用程序的身份和安全性,以便在App Store上发布应用程序。

在iOS开发中,证书用于签署应用程序。签署应用程序是将应用程序与开发者的身份信息绑定在一起的过程。这使得应用程序在用户设备上运行时可以验证其身份和安全性。签署应用程序需要使用开发者账户和证书。在签署应用程序之前,开发者需要创建证书,并将其与他们的开发者账户相关联。

iOS证书的种类

iOS证书可以分为三种类型:开发证书、发布证书和中间证书。开发证书用于在开发期间测试应用程序。发布证书用于发布应用程序到App Store。中间证书用于验证开发证书和发布证书的关系。

开发证书

开发证书是一种用于在开发期间测试应用程序的证书。它们是由苹果公司颁发的,用于验证开发者的身份和安全性。开发证书包括开发者身份信息和公钥。开发者使用私钥来签署应用程序,以便在设备上运行。

发布证书

发布证书是一种用于发布应用程序到App Store的证书。它们也是由苹果公司颁发的,用于验证开发者的身份和安全性。发布证书包括开发者身份信息和公钥。开发者使用私钥来签署应用程序,以便在设备上运行。

中间证书

中间证书用于验证开发证书和发布证书的关系。它们是由苹果公司颁发的,用于确保开发者使用正确的证书签署应用程序。中间证书包括苹果公司的身份信息和公钥。

iOS证书的创建和管理

在创建和管理iOS证书时,开发者需要使用开发者账户。开发者账户是与苹果公司相关联的账户,用于开发iOS应用程序。开发者账户包括开发者身份信息和证书。

创建证书

要创建iOS证书,开发者需要登录到他们的开发者账户。然后,他们需要选择证书类型,并提供必要的信息,如开发者名称和电子邮件地址。一旦证书被创建,开发者可以将其下载到他们的计算机上,并在Xcode中使用它来签署应用程序。

管理证书

开发者可以使用Xcode或开发者账户管理工具来管理他们的iOS证书。他们可以查看证书详细信息,如证书类型,有效期和公钥。他们也可以删除过期或不再需要的证书。

总结

iOS证书是用于验证应用程序身份和安全性的数字证书。它们是由苹果公司颁发的,用于开发和发布iOS应用程序。开发者需要使用开发者账户来创建和管理证书。iOS证书分为开发证书、发布证书和中间证书三种类型。开发者可以使用Xcode或开发者账户管理工具来管理他们的iOS证书。


相关知识:
苹果软件签名后闪退
苹果软件签名是苹果公司为了保障用户安全而推出的一种措施。签名后的软件在被安装时会被苹果系统认证,从而保证软件的可靠性和安全性。然而,在使用签名后的软件时,有时会出现闪退的情况,这是为什么呢?首先,我们需要了解一下苹果软件签名的原理。苹果软件签名是通过使用开
2023-04-07
苹果证书怎么用
苹果证书是苹果公司为开发者提供的一种数字签名证书,可以用于验证开发者的身份以及保证应用程序的安全性。苹果证书的使用可以使得开发者的应用程序在用户的设备中得到更好的信任度和安全性。本文将详细介绍苹果证书的原理以及使用方法。一、苹果证书的原理苹果证书采用了公钥
2023-04-07
苹果签名怎么自己搞
苹果签名是指将应用程序或软件打包并签署数字证书,以便在iOS设备上安装和使用。苹果签名的目的是确保应用程序的安全性和完整性,并防止用户安装未经授权的应用程序。本文将介绍苹果签名的原理以及如何自己搞苹果签名。一、苹果签名的原理苹果签名的原理是基于公钥加密和数
2023-04-07
苹果的证书信任设置
苹果的证书信任设置是指在苹果设备上设置的一种安全机制,用于保证用户的数据和隐私的安全。它通过对数字证书的认证和验证,确定网站或应用程序的真实性和可信度,从而保障用户在使用设备时的安全。数字证书是一种用于验证网站或应用程序身份的电子凭证,由数字签名机构(CA
2023-04-07
苹果6s降级证书
苹果6s降级证书,指的是一种通过特殊手段获取的证书,可以让用户将其设备的系统版本降级到较旧的版本。这种证书通常被用于解决一些兼容性问题,或是获取更高的越狱成功率。那么,苹果6s降级证书是如何实现的呢?首先,我们需要了解一个概念——SHSH2。SHSH2是苹
2023-04-07
公司证书如何测试苹果app
苹果的iOS系统为了保障其App Store的安全性,采用了严格的应用审核机制。开发者需要通过苹果的审核才能将自己的应用发布到App Store上。而公司证书是一种苹果提供的开发者工具,可以让开发者在不经过App Store审核的情况下将应用分发给公司内部
2023-04-07
ios签名管理
iOS签名管理是指在开发和发布iOS应用程序时,对应用程序进行数字签名以确保应用程序的完整性和真实性,同时也是苹果公司对应用程序进行验证的重要手段。本文将详细介绍iOS签名管理的原理和实现方法。一、iOS签名管理的原理iOS签名管理的原理是将应用程序进行数
2023-04-07
ios签名服务承诺
iOS签名服务是一种通过苹果开发者账号对应用程序进行数字签名的服务。该服务可以保证应用程序在被安装到用户设备时不会被篡改,从而保障了应用程序的安全性。iOS签名服务的原理是基于公钥加密算法和数字签名技术。在iOS签名服务中,开发者需要先将应用程序提交到苹果
2023-04-07
ios推送证书信息
iOS推送证书是用于实现APNs(Apple Push Notification service)功能的一种凭证,它是一个由苹果颁发的数字证书,用于标识推送服务所属的应用程序和服务器。在iOS应用程序中,推送证书是实现远程通知的必要条件,只有获得了推送证书
2023-04-07
iosfastlane证书
iOS Fastlane是一个非常流行的自动化工具,它可以帮助开发人员自动化iOS应用程序的构建,测试和部署。其中一个关键的组成部分就是证书管理。在本文中,我们将介绍iOS Fastlane证书的原理和详细介绍。首先,我们需要了解什么是iOS证书。iOS证
2023-04-07
ios15 怎么安装证书
iOS 15 是苹果公司最新的操作系统版本,它带来了许多新的功能和改进。其中一个新功能是允许用户安装自定义证书,以便在设备上安装自定义应用程序或配置文件。本文将介绍 iOS 15 中如何安装证书的原理和详细步骤。证书的原理在 iOS 中,证书是一种安全机制
2023-04-07
ios14信任证书设置
iOS 14是苹果公司最新的移动操作系统版本,它的安全性得到了极大的提升。在使用iOS 14时,我们可能需要安装一些应用程序或配置文件,这些文件需要我们信任其证书。本文将介绍iOS 14信任证书设置的原理和详细步骤。一、信任证书的原理在iOS系统中,有一种
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4